maybe a related question for this thread: I added a custom.csv "detector window" for the widely used windowless SuperX-SDD by FEI/TFS. I copied the detector efficiency curve from Fig. 4b here (https://www.researchgate.net/publication/281539024_Nanoscale_chemical_compositional_analysis_with_an_innovative_STEM-EDX_system), but it is actually the full detector efficiency instead of only the window transmission (the latter I could not find).
If I set this custom.csv in the detector config, would you recommend setting the SDD thickness to some arbitrary higher number such as 5 mm? As I understand, a SDD config with the default 0.45 mm and my custom.csv "window" may "double" the drop-off effect after around 10 keV (?).

Increasing the thickness seems like a good idea. 5 mm would be enough or you could go higher.
Great, thank you!
I increased the Si thickness to 10 mm (as you note, more will not hurt) and after a restart of DTSA it works as expected.
